Nick Steele & Kristen Flowers of 99.5 The Wolf (KWJJ/Portland) to Receive Tom Rivers Humanitarian Award During CRS 2026
(Nashville, Tennessee — January 20, 2026) — Country Radio Broadcasters, Inc. (CRB) will honor Nick Steele and Kristen Flowers, morning show hosts on Audacy’s 99.5 The Wolf (KWJJ-FM) in Portland, with the Tom Rivers Humanitarian Award during CRS 2026, set for March 18–20 at the Omni Nashville Hotel.
Named after broadcast veteran Tom Rivers, the award celebrates his legacy by recognizing individuals in the country radio industry who exemplify a magnanimous spirit of caring and generosity through hands-on community service. Recipients demonstrate a deep personal commitment of time, talent, and resources to meaningful causes, reflecting the very best of country radio.
Rivers passed away in 2004 at the age of 38. At the time of his passing, he was a member of the CRB Board of Directors and served as Operations Manager at WUSN (99.5 FM) in Chicago. His distinguished career also included time at WQYK (99.5 FM) in Tampa.
Steele and Flowers are being honored for their extraordinary philanthropic leadership through Nick & Kristen’s Medical Debt Payoff, an annual initiative now in its sixth year. During the most recent campaign, held Nov. 17–21, 2025, the duo raised enough funds to eliminate $2.17 million in local medical debt across the Pacific Northwest. The effort was conducted in partnership with national nonprofit Undue Medical Debt.
Since its inception, Nick & Kristen’s Medical Debt Payoff has raised more than $18 million, fully relieving medical debt for over 10,000 individuals and families throughout the region, providing life-changing financial relief, and restoring dignity to those impacted by unexpected medical hardship.
Past recipients of the Tom Rivers Humanitarian Award include Mark “Hawkeye” Louis, Tim Leary, Storme Warren, Heather Froglear, Lon Helton, Bill Lawson, Dan Halyburton, Peter Smyth, Jeff Smulyan, Mary Quaas, and George G. Beasley.
